Additional Information
Schieder, one of Europe’s largest furniture producers (employing 11,600 people at 40 plants across Europe), has gone bankrupt. Some 8,000 jobs are at stake in Poland. The primary cause of the company’s financial difficulties lay in the unexpected spike in timber prices as well as in the fact that labour costs in Poland turned out to be higher than anticipated. Schieder’s Polish operations comprise Bydgoskie Fabryki Mebli, ETAP, Mazurskie Meble Trading, Mazur Comfort, Mazur Look, FS Favorit Furniture, Mazur Direct, HF Helevita, Flair Polsnad, Top Sofa, Tapicernia Gniewkowo, IMS, and Nowa E.
